Subject: Loyalty overhaul – heads up

Team,

Short version: the Corvane Rewards programme gets rebuilt next quarter. Points expiry goes, tier thresholds drop, and the partner perks with Hollis Retail get expanded. Sales leads should hold off promising anything to key accounts until the new terms are final. Mira owns the rollout; Jens owns comms. Timeline lands Friday. Budget impact is modest but real — details in the deck. Keep this tight until launch. Rationale follows below.

internal memo for taguf-kafop: Novmirax Group plans to lower the Oliius list price by 42.0 percent in March. The board signed off on a budget of $367.8 million for Project Belael. The renewal with Drumirax Logistics closes at $302.4 million a year, 54.0 percent below the last contract. Project Kelys slips by a full year because of the staffing delay.

## Fixture Factories in Mockhaven

Mockhaven is our test-data factory library — think of it as a recipe box for realistic-ish records. Each factory declares defaults, and traits layer overrides on top. One gotcha: bulk generation is throttled so CI databases don't balloon, and sequences wrap rather than grow forever. Before you write a new factory, check the built-in caps, which are set as follows.

tuning table, kajog-bawip:
TIERS = {
    "kelius": 256,
    "lammir": 543,
}

Subject: Bramleigh line pricing — quick read

Team,

Short one: we're moving ahead with the revised price book for the Bramleigh line next quarter. List goes up modestly; volume discounts tighten. Heads of department, please brief your teams before the announcement so nobody's surprised.

Feedback welcome by Friday. There's one sensitive detail you need to see first.

confidential, kagup-bafog: Fraaxax Group is in early talks to buy Soroxox Group for about $343.8 million. The Olidor launch date is June 14, and nothing goes to the press before then. Legal wants the Aldmirek Logistics term sheet signed before July 23.

# This client talks to the Ledgerline migration coordinator, which
# enforces the expand/migrate/contract sequence. Never run contract
# phases manually during an incident: the coordinator verifies that
# all readers have drained the old schema version first, and bypassing
# it can strand in-flight writes. If a migration stalls, use the
# pause endpoint rather than killing the process — state is resumable.
# The client authenticates with a coordinator key scoped to
# migrations:apply, rotated weekly. The current key follows.

gateway credential: kto3_qfe